Charlie Davies left off US World Cup training roster

In a surprising decision, US soccer star Charlie Davies will not get the chance to represent USA at World Cup 2010. The star forward's name was left off the training camp roster. Davies was attempting to come back to the national team seven months after a nearly fatal car crash left him with broken bones, a ruptured bladder, and bleeding in the brain. Though his rehabilitation was going well, he was not given a full medical release to attend the training camp.

30 players gather next week in Princeton, New Jersey for training camp. Coach Bradley will select the top 23 for the final World Cup 2010 roster. The Americans open their World Cup campaign against England on June 12.
